History & Origin

Baby is the everyday English word for an infant. As an entry in name data it most often reflects a placeholder or administrative record, not a typical given name, which we note honestly - a brief, transparent entry (said 'BAY-bee').

It appears only rarely and unusually in U.S. name data. Rare, word-based, and administrative.

Did you know? Baby is simply the English word for an infant; when it turns up in name records it is usually a placeholder or administrative entry rather than a deliberately chosen name, which we note honestly (said 'BAY-bee').
